Bolivia: Morales seeks to downplay police scandal

Ahead of the October general election, the Movimiento al Socialismo (MAS) government led by President Evo Morales is seeking to downplay a major corruption scandal in the police, which links some of the force’s highest-ranking members in Santa Cruz to narcotrafficker Pedro Montenegro Paz. The scandal has led the government to introduce “drastic measures” and counterintelligence to “sanitise” the Bolivian police, while President Morales has continued to resist pressure to dismiss his interior minister Carlos Romero.
